Sorry, this listing is no longer accepting applications. Don’t worry, we have more awesome opportunities and internships for you.

Java Developer

Ubiquisoft Technologies

Java Developer

National
Full Time
Paid
  • Responsibilities

    Ubiquisoft Technologies is seeking a full-time Java Developer to join our development team.

    As a member of our team, you will design and build the next generation of software for Ubiquisoft clients and in-house products.  From initial product concept to production support this position encompasses the full development lifecycle. Each developer can work remotely or if in town they are offered a private windowed office at our location in Germantown, TN.

    CORE RESPONSIBILITIES

    • Object model concept, design, and coding
    • Design and develop REST-based APIs
    • Coordinate the development, implementation, installation, development, and operation of systems for various organizations
    • Coding with the company chosen technologies and framework
    • Consult with management and staff on upcoming projects

    QUALIFICATIONS AND EXPERIENCE

    • 2+ years of Java, backend, or full-stack programming experience
    • Mastery of core Java and OOP design principles
    • Experience with Spring (specifically Spring Boot and Data JPA)
    • RESTful API backend integration and development experience
    • Professionalism required (attitude, appearance, and communication)
    • A true passion to be self-taught and explore new technologies on your own
    • Ability to research and resolve programming problems with minimal supervision
    • Open to accepting feedback and ability to follow direction of technical leads
    • BS in Computer Science, equivalent technical degree, or work experience
    • Authorized to work in the United States and pass a criminal background check
    • H-1B Visa Sponsorship is not available for this position

    NICE TO HAVE

    • Experience working in an Agile team
    • Experience with MySQL/mariaDB and Oracle
    • Front-end or Full-Stack development experience
    • An eye for aesthetics and UX

    ABOUT UBIQUISOFT TECHNOLOGIES

    Ubiquisoft Technologies is a full life-cycle development group from initial analysis to production support.  We provide 24x7x365 support for Fortune 500 companies and small businesses alike.